37, Highdown Court Varndean Drive, Brighton, BN1 6TF is a leasehold flat built between 1967-1975. The property offers approximately 893 square feet of living space and is situated on the 3rd floor. In this location, apartments of similar size usually have three bedrooms.

The estimated current market value of the property is £377,865 , which equates to approximately £423 per square foot. It was last sold on 9 Aug 2002 for £162,000. Since then, the value has increased by £215,865, representing a 133.3% increase, or approximately 5.7% per year.

The current estimated value of £377,865 is:

  • 36.6% lower than the average property price on Varndean Drive
  • 6.8% lower than the average in the BN1 6TF postcode area
  • and 8.5% higher than the average price for Brighton as a whole

EPC Summary

37, Highdown Court Varndean Drive, Brighton, Brighton And Hove, East Sussex, BN1 6TF has an Energy Performance Certificate (EPC) rating of D, based on the latest assessment carried out on 11 Sep 2019.

This property uses a gas-fired boiler and radiators, connected to the mains gas supply, as its main heating source. Hot water is provided from main heating system. The windows are fully double glazed.

The previous EPC assessment was conducted on 10 Sep 2009. The rating of D remains the same, but the energy efficiency score improved by 7.3%.

Since the previous assessment, several changes were observed:

  • The lighting was updated from no low energy lighting to low energy lighting in 50% of fixed outlets, with efficiency improving from very poor to good.
